WR Brandon Hayes has signed and been waived several times over the past few months by the Eagles; brought back again after less than a week off the roster. Undrafted rookie free agent wide receiver Brandon Hayes was waived by the Eagles to make room for linebacker Brandon George. Hayes faced a stacked WR room in Philadelphia and was the first casualty; he originally signed in May, was released in June, re-signed in early August, but could not hold a roster spot. The Philadelphia Eagles re-signed undrafted rookie free agent wide receiver Brandon Hayes to provide receiver depth amid injuries to DeVonta Smith (hamstring), Makai Lemon (hamstring), and Britain Covey (injury unclear). Hayes originally participated in the Eagles' rookie minicamp on a tryout basis in early May before being signed ahead of their first media-attended OTA practice on May 27, then waived on June 6 to make room for the Zion Wilson signing. His re-signing gives the Eagles an extra practice body in training camp with some familiarity of their system to help fill reps.
